  • Belfast Schools Cross Country Championships

    The annual Belfast Schools Cross Country Championships return in February and March this year.

  • Who can take part?

    There will be two races on the days of the events.

    One boy’s race and one girl’s race which are for P6 and/or P7 pupils.

    Each school can enter teams of up to eight athletes, as well as reserves.

  • Race venues and dates

    There are four regional heats which are held at parks throughout Belfast.

    Primary schools can enter into their heat and have the chance to qualify for the Belfast Final. 

    It is important for all schools to arrive at your heat for 10am on the day. We would also like to ask that the schools that will be attending the Belfast Final could stay for the medal and trophy presentation so that photographs can be taken.

    Race  Venue Date (2023)
    Primary school - north Belfast heat Grove Park Wednesday 22 February
    Primary school - east Belfast heat Orangefield Park Thursday 23 February
    Primary school - west Belfast heat Boucher Road Playing Fields Tuesday 28 February
    Primary school - south Belfast heat Ormeau Park Thursday 2 March
    Belfast primary school final Mallusk Playing Fields Thursday 23 March
